I. Core Pain Points of Traditional Warehousing
1. Cost Pressure
The land rent and labor costs of traditional warehousing continue to rise, further increasing operational costs. Enterprises are faced with the dilemma of either renting larger warehouses or reducing inventory turnover efficiency, both of which can harm the business.
2. Low Space Utilization
The layer height and spacing of traditional shelves are difficult to adjust. When the size of goods changes, it easily leads to space waste.
3. Poor Flexibility
It is unable to adapt to inventory fluctuations in industries such as e-commerce and seasonal products, and cannot quickly respond to market changes. Renting larger warehouses or reducing inventory turnover efficiency will directly affect the profitability of the enterprise.
II. Product Design and Core Features of Stacking Racks
1. Design Concept
Primarily adopts an assembly design, with adjustable layer heights, further breaking the rigid limitations of traditional storage racks.
2. Core Components
Mainly consists of uprights, beams, and shelves, allowing for flexible adjustment of each layer's height based on the size and weight of stored items.
3. Four Core Features
Three-dimensional: Multi-layer design, making full use of vertical space.
Adjustable: Layer heights can be adjusted to accommodate different goods.
High Load Capacity: High-strength structure ensures safety.
Easy Assembly: No welding required, easy to disassemble and assemble, reducing installation time.
4. Diverse Types
Gradually developed into various types such as fixed, foldable, and wheeled mobile, to adapt to different scenarios.

III. Typical Industry Applications
The application scenarios of Stacking Rack are extremely extensive. From e-commerce warehousing to cold chain logistics, the industries it is applied to are constantly expanding, actively promoting the transformation of industry storage methods.
1. Electronics Manufacturing
With adjustable Stacking Rack, it can quickly adapt to product iterations, reducing the overall adjustment time by about 70%.
With the overall warehouse area remaining unchanged, Stacking Rack can significantly increase storage capacity and further reduce annual rent.
2. Cold Chain Logistics Industry
Special low-temperature Stacking Rack can be used to optimize the air flow in cold storage, and the utilization rate of space can be increased to about 80%.
Reducing ineffective refrigeration space, the annual energy saving can be over 30%.
3. E-commerce Industry
Expandable Stacking Rack can help warehouses cope with the challenge of surging orders during e-commerce promotions.
Different industries have their own unique characteristics, so the requirements for choosing Stacking Rack will also vary. The automotive parts manufacturing industry needs to choose heavy-duty Stacking Rack with higher load-bearing capacity; the pharmaceutical industry pays more attention to the cleanliness and anti-corrosion performance of Stacking Rack; the fast-moving consumer goods industry will prioritize flexible and easily adjustable styles.

IV. Economic Benefits of the Stacking Rack System
By adopting the Stacking Rack system, enterprises have achieved a comprehensive optimization of warehouse space utilization, overall costs, and operational efficiency.
1. Direct improvement in space utilization
A well-designed Stacking Rack can increase the warehouse space utilization rate by more than 85% compared to traditional methods, helping enterprises delay or avoid warehouse expansion.
2. Reduction in overall costs
The Stacking Rack is highly flexible and can be reused, thus avoiding the waste of traditional Stacking Rack usage once and for all, and significantly reducing the overall usage cost.
3. Enhancement of operational efficiency
The standardized design of the Stacking Rack enables a clearer and more visible placement of goods during transportation, significantly reducing the time spent by staff in searching for and retrieving goods, and the operational efficiency can be increased by approximately 15% to 25%.
V. Future Development Trends of Stacking Rack
With the advancement of technology and changes in market demands, Stacking Rack is gradually moving towards an intelligent, lightweight and specialized direction.
1. Intelligent Development
With the gradual integration of Internet technologies, through intelligent sensors, it is possible to further implement load monitoring, prevent overloading, and be able to interface with management systems to achieve dynamic optimization of storage locations.
2. Lightweight
Gradually adopting high-strength and optimized structural designs, while ensuring load-bearing capacity, it can also significantly reduce its own weight, thereby gradually reducing the cost of raw materials and making the installation position adjustment more convenient.
3. Specialization
It can gradually develop more products based on the specific needs of different industries:
- Anti-static Stacking Rack suitable for the electronics industry
- Clean-type Stacking Rack suitable for the food and pharmaceutical industries
- Automated compatible Stacking Rack that can also be used in the intelligent warehousing industry
